Your consumer rights in new zealand
New Zealand law protects your rights when you cancel subscription services, and Fiit's own terms acknowledge these protections.
The 14-day right of withdrawal
Fiit's Terms and Conditions state that if you subscribe directly through the Fiit website, you have a 14-day cancellation period after sign-up during which you can cancel without being charged. This right applies to new subscriptions purchased via the Fiit platform itself. Once the 14-day period ends, Fiit's standard policy does not guarantee a refund unless the law requires one.
Pro tip: Mark your calendar for day 14 after you sign up. If you decide Fiit is not for you, cancel within this window to avoid being charged for a full billing cycle.
Consumer guarantees act protections
Under New Zealand's Consumer Guarantees Act, you have the right to services that are fit for purpose and delivered with due care and skill. If Fiit fails to deliver the service as advertised or described, you may be entitled to a refund, replacement, or repair, regardless of Fiit's cancellation policy.
If Fiit's app is not functioning, content is unavailable, or the service quality is materially below what was promised, Stopee recommends documenting the issue and contacting Fiit support. If the company refuses to help, you can escalate your complaint to the Commerce Commission or seek advice from a consumer advocate.
Third-party payment protection
If you subscribed through Apple App Store, Google Play, Amazon, or another payment processor, you are also protected by that platform's refund policy. These third parties often offer their own cancellation windows and refund rights, which may be more generous than Fiit's own policy. Always check the terms of your payment provider first.
How to cancel fiit if you subscribed directly
If you signed up and paid through the Fiit website or app directly, follow these steps to cancel your membership.
Step-by-step cancellation process
- Open the Fiit mobile app on your phone or tablet.
- Log in if you are not already signed in.
- Navigate to your Profile section.
- Look for the profile icon, usually located at the bottom of the home screen.
- Tap the settings cog or gear icon.
- This opens your account settings menu.
- Select Membership.
- You will see your current subscription status and renewal date.
- Tap Manage.
- This screen shows your full membership details and your cancellation option.
- Select Cancel Membership.
- Fiit may show you a retention offer or ask why you are leaving.
- Confirm your cancellation when prompted.
Warning: Cancel at least 72 hours before your next billing date to avoid being charged for another month. Fiit processes cancellations within this window, and cutting it closer puts you at risk of an unwanted charge.
What happens after you cancel direct fiit subscriptions
Your access to Fiit continues until the end of your current billing period. You will not lose your account, progress data, or workout history immediately. However, once your billing period ends, your access stops and you cannot stream new classes unless you resubscribe.
Pro tip: Download any workout summaries or progress data you want to keep before your access expires. While Fiit does not delete your account automatically, storing your own records ensures you have them permanently.
How to cancel if you subscribed via apple, google, or amazon
Many New Zealand users subscribe through app store payment systems rather than paying Fiit directly. The cancellation steps differ depending on your payment platform.
Cancel through apple app store
- On your iPhone or iPad, open the Settings app.
- Do not open Fiit itself; use your device settings.
- Tap your Apple ID name at the top of the screen.
- If you see "iTunes & App Stores" instead, tap that option first.
- Select Subscriptions.
- You will see all active subscriptions tied to your Apple ID.
- Find Fiit in the list and tap it.
- If you do not see Fiit, scroll down or search for it.
- Tap Cancel Subscription.
- Apple will ask you to confirm and may show you offers to stay.
- Confirm your cancellation.
- Your access ends at the end of the current billing period.
Warning: Cancel at least 24 hours before your renewal date. Apple processes cancellations within 24 hours, and timing is essential to avoid charges.
Cancel through google play store
- Open the Google Play Store app on your Android phone or tablet.
- Make sure you are using the device where you manage subscriptions.
- Tap your Profile icon in the top right corner.
- Usually a circular image or initial.
- Select Payments and subscriptions.
- You may need to choose "Account" first, then "Payments and subscriptions."
- Tap Subscriptions.
- A list of all active subscriptions appears.
- Find Fiit and tap it.
- Your subscription details open.
- Select Cancel subscription.
- Google will confirm your cancellation.
- Access continues until the end of your current billing cycle.
Pro tip: On Google Play, you can choose to cancel immediately or let it expire at the end of your cycle. If you want to stop using Fiit right away but keep access until the renewal date, select the option that suits you best.
Cancel through amazon or other third-party platforms
If you subscribed through Amazon Prime Video Channels, Roku, Samsung TV, or another third-party app store, you must cancel through that specific platform, not through Fiit itself. Fiit cannot process these cancellations on your behalf.
- Log in to your account on the third-party platform where you subscribed.
- For example, if you subscribed through Amazon Prime Video, log in to amazon.com.
- Navigate to your subscriptions or channel settings.
- Each platform organises this differently; check their help section if you are unsure.
- Find Fiit and select Manage or Unsubscribe.
- Follow the platform's cancellation prompts.
- Confirm cancellation.
- You will receive confirmation via email from the platform.
Refunds and what to expect when you cancel
Refunds are not guaranteed once your subscription is active, but your rights depend on how you paid and when you cancel.
Refunds for direct fiit subscriptions
If you subscribed directly through Fiit, you have a 14-day window from sign-up to cancel without being charged. After this period, Fiit's policy states that subscriptions are non-refundable unless you have a legal right to a refund under consumer law.
Warning: Do not wait until day 15 if you want a refund on a new subscription. Cancel on day 14 or earlier to guarantee protection under Fiit's stated policy.
If Fiit has breached the Consumer Guarantees Act (for example, the service did not work as advertised or was not fit for purpose), you may be entitled to a refund even after the 14-day period. Stopee recommends contacting Fiit support in writing, detailing what went wrong, and asking for a refund based on the Consumer Guarantees Act.
Refunds for apple, google, and third-party subscriptions
Refunds for payments made through Apple App Store, Google Play, Amazon, or other platforms are subject to those providers' own refund policies, not Fiit's policy. Apple and Google typically offer a 15-minute grace period after purchase during which you can request a refund automatically. After that, refunds depend on their broader policies.
- Apple App Store: You can request refunds on app purchases and subscriptions within 15 minutes of purchase through your Apple ID account. After 15 minutes, refunds are not automatic, but you can contact Apple Support with a reason, and they may refund you as a one-time courtesy.
- Google Play: You have 48 hours to request a refund for most subscription charges. Log in to play.google.com, find the Fiit subscription, and select Request refund.
- Amazon Prime Video Channels: Check Amazon's refund policy for channels; typically, you can request a refund if you cancel within 24 hours of the charge.
Pro tip: Always check your email for a confirmation receipt after you pay. The receipt shows the refund window and process for your specific payment method. Stopee advises keeping these receipts for at least 30 days in case you need to dispute a charge.
Free trial cancellations
If you subscribed to a free trial, you will not be charged if you cancel before the trial ends. However, if you forget to cancel and the trial expires, you will be charged for your first billing cycle. Cancelling a free trial removes it from your account and prevents any charges.
Set a phone reminder 3 days before your trial ends so you do not forget to cancel if you decide Fiit is not for you.
Your account and data after cancellation
Cancelling your Fiit subscription does not automatically delete your account or erase your progress data, which is both helpful and something you should be aware of.
What stays in your account
Your workout history, progress stats, personal goals, and profile information remain in Fiit's system even after you cancel. Your account remains under your name and email address. If you decide to resubscribe in the future, you can log back in and pick up where you left off.
If you want to delete your account
If you do not want Fiit to keep your data, you can request account deletion by contacting Fiit support. Fiit's Help Centre includes a contact form, or you can look for a "Delete Account" option in your app settings under Privacy or Account Options.
Stopee recommends sending a written request to Fiit asking for full account deletion, not just cancellation. Include your account email and request confirmation once your data is removed. Keep a copy of your request for your records.

Common mistakes to avoid when cancelling fiit
Cancelling can feel stressful, especially if you worry about surprise charges or losing access to your data too soon. Here are the pitfalls that catch New Zealand users and how to sidestep them.
Waiting too close to your renewal date
The number one mistake is cancelling on the day before your renewal instead of 72 hours (or 24 hours for Apple) in advance. Fiit and app stores process cancellations within a specific timeframe, and if you miss it, you will be charged for another cycle and have to request a refund.
Set a calendar reminder for day 1 of each month if you know you want to cancel. This gives you a full month to process the cancellation and avoid the panic of a last-minute rush.
Cancelling in the app instead of through your payment method
If you subscribed through Apple or Google, you must cancel through those platforms, not through the Fiit app. Cancelling in the Fiit app alone does not stop Apple or Google from charging you. Stopee has seen hundreds of New Zealand customers miss this step and end up charged despite thinking they had cancelled.
Warning: Always verify where you subscribed, then cancel in that exact location. If you are unsure, check your bank or credit card statement for the charge source; it will show whether Apple, Google, Fiit, or another platform is billing you.
Not checking your email for confirmation
After you cancel, your payment provider (Fiit, Apple, Google, Amazon) sends a confirmation email. Do not assume the cancellation went through until you see this email. If you do not receive confirmation within 24 hours, log back in and verify that your subscription status shows as "cancelled" or "expired."
Ignoring retention offers
When you try to cancel, Fiit may offer you a discounted month or pause your subscription instead of cancelling. If you genuinely want to cancel, do not accept these offers unless you have changed your mind. Accepting pauses or discounts keeps you subscribed and may lead to unexpected charges later.
